GENERAL TRAFFIC CONTROL, SAFETY, & ACCESS <br /> A. The contractor shall keep the sidewalk open at all times. If a sidewalk closure is <br /> necessary, contractor shall first obtain permission from the City Engineer and <br /> then shall make provisions for an alternate pedestrian access. <br /> B. At no time shall pedestrians be diverted onto a portion of the street used for <br /> vehicular traffic. At locations where safe alternate passageways cannot be <br /> provided, appropriate signs and barricades shall be installed at the limit of <br /> construction and in advance of the limits of construction at the nearest crosswalk <br /> or intersection to detour pedestrians. <br /> C. The contractor agrees to assume sole and complete responsibility for job site <br /> conditions during the course of construction of this project, including safety of all <br /> persons and property. <br /> D. Access to businesses shall be provided at all times. <br /> VIII. DAMAGES FOR DELAYS <br /> A.
